A Western medical doctor reveals how and why acupuncture really works. Acupuncture, once considered a fringe alternative, is quickly becoming part of mainstream American medicine. Recent scientific studies have recommended the procedure as a safe and effective treatment for myriad health conditions - from asthma to tennis elbow. Now Dr. Glenn S. Rothfeld shares the firsthand experiences of patients who have successfully merged acupuncture into their regular medical treatment plans and explores the research that helps prove that it works. The topics include: making acupuncture part of a total health care plan; finding a qualified acupuncturist; obtaining insurance coverage; knowing what to expect in a first visit to an acupuncturist; and learning which diseases and conditions acupuncture may help improve.

À propos de Glenn Rothfeld

Glenn S. Rothfeld, M.D., M.Ac., (Arlington, MA) is a medical doctor who holds a master's degree in acupuncture, a clinical assistant professor at Tufts University School of Medicine, and the medical director of WholeHealth New England, Inc., in Arlington, MA. Suzanne LeVert (New Orleans, LA) is the author or coauthor of more than 25 health and medical books for general audiences.
